Promote Quality Rest for Peak Male Strength

In our fast-paced, modern world, the emphasis on physical fitness and strength often overshadows a crucial component of achieving peak performance: quality rest. Many men seek to enhance their strength through rigorous training regimens; however, the path to building muscle and improving athletic capabilities is incomplete without adequate rest and recovery. Understanding the science behind rest can lead to better training outcomes and overall well-being.

Rest is not merely a break from physical activity; it is an essential part of any strength-building program. When men engage in strength training exercises, they create micro-tears in their muscle fibers. These tears are a natural part of the muscle-building process, known as hypertrophy. However, it is during rest periods that the body repairs these tears, ultimately resulting in stronger and larger muscles. Failure to prioritize rest can lead to overtraining, which may cause injury, fatigue, and stagnation in strength gains.

One of the critical components of quality rest is sleep. Research shows that adequate sleep is vital for muscle recovery and growth. During deep sleep stages, the body secretes growth hormone, which plays a significant role in protein synthesis and muscle repair. Men typically require around 7-9 hours of sleep each night, but individual needs can vary. Paying attention to sleep quality can be just as important as ensuring enough hours are clocked in. A restful night’s sleep includes a cool, dark environment, limited screen exposure before bedtime, and relaxation techniques such as deep breathing or meditation.

In addition to nightly sleep, rest days should be an integral part of any strength training program. These scheduled breaks allow the body to recover from the rigors of intense workouts. On rest days, men can engage in lighter activities such as walking, yoga, or other low-impact exercises that promote blood flow without placing excessive strain on the muscles. This active recovery can enhance overall fitness and support continued progress in strength training.

Nutrition also plays a pivotal role in the restoration process. Proper fueling of the body, especially after intense workouts, can enhance recovery times and optimize performance. Consuming a balanced diet that includes a healthy mix of proteins, fats, carbohydrates, vitamins, and minerals provides the necessary building blocks for muscle repair. Protein, in particular, is crucial for muscle synthesis; incorporating protein-rich foods post-workout can help expedite recovery.

Hydration is another often-overlooked aspect of recovery that directly impacts performance and strength. Water plays a vital role in every bodily function, including nutrient transport and digestion. Dehydration can lead to fatigue, decreased strength, and slowed recovery times. Therefore, men must prioritize hydration, especially during and after workouts.
